diff --git a/src/hooks/useNovuNotifications.ts b/src/hooks/useNovuNotifications.ts index 28a81948..a3113a7d 100644 --- a/src/hooks/useNovuNotifications.ts +++ b/src/hooks/useNovuNotifications.ts @@ -1,9 +1,11 @@ import { useAuth } from '@/hooks/useAuth'; +import { useAdminSettings } from '@/hooks/useAdminSettings'; export function useNovuNotifications() { const { user } = useAuth(); + const { getSettingValue } = useAdminSettings(); - const applicationIdentifier = import.meta.env.VITE_NOVU_APPLICATION_IDENTIFIER; + const applicationIdentifier = getSettingValue('novu.application_identifier', ''); const subscriberId = user?.id; const isEnabled = !!applicationIdentifier && !!subscriberId;